On December 12, NAA’s Executive Committee sat down with Representative Steve Stivers (R-OH-15) to discuss leading policy concerns of the apartment industry including resident screening, housing affordability, Section 8 reform, flood insurance and emotional support animals. A recognized consensus-builder known for his effectiveness at working across the aisle, Congressman Stivers was recently named the Ranking Republican on the Housing, Community Development and Insurance Subcommittee of the House Financial Services Committee. In this important role, his voice will be crucial as the Committee considers many issues within its jurisdiction that impact rental housing. The Congressman is in his fifth term as a member of the House of Representatives and represents the Columbus area of Ohio.

During the meeting, he held aloft his cell phone and showed the Executive Committee how easily he was able to register his dog as an emotional support animal and indicated that he fully understands the challenges housing providers face with fraudulent ESA documentation.
